Output 57839e72c4d6ab8539c75a151dd31811e4209e7f8f49a7ed251a2fcb1225f8a6:0

value
844648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6578fac2fc903aa9312afb763af9bb5f6db1a5e OP_EQUAL
address
3KmkcPNMvqYabN97cFppyXxCJaMVQpanLW
transaction
57839e72c4d6ab8539c75a151dd31811e4209e7f8f49a7ed251a2fcb1225f8a6
spent
true